> As Constantin said, you need to do some debugging.  First, run Evolution
> from the command line.  If there are any errors, then they will be
> shown.  If that doesn't show anything, then run Evolution with debugging
> enabled.  See:
> 
>   https://wiki.gnome.org/Apps/Evolution/Debugging
> 
> The debug variable for EWS isn't shown there, but I think it's EWS_DEBUG
> (although no doubt someone will correct me if I'm wrong).  So just do 
> 
>   EWS_DEBUG=1 evolution >& logfile
> 
> Any errors communicating with the server should be obvious.
